Break-glass access — Pooler subsystem (new team members). Our Mistgrove services share a central connection pooler; under normal operation you never touch it directly. In a break-glass scenario, such as pool exhaustion taking down the Ledgerbird API, you may bypass the pooler and connect to the primary with the emergency role. This is logged and reviewed. The emergency role's credential store is sealed, and opening it during an incident requires the recovery passphrase that appears directly below this paragraph.

strongbox words: fraath-isteth

// Quick orientation for the Fenwick firmware update channel.
// This client pulls signed firmware bundles from the internal
// Relaystone service and pushes them to enrolled devices. Don't
// point it at prod until your test fleet passes — seriously.
// Channel is "beta" by default; override via config. Auth uses
// the service key on the next line.

API key for tagug-tajef: vxb4-R1fo

Welcome aboard. Firmware updates for Lanternfox devices ship through the Relay channel service. Builds move from canary to stable only after soak testing passes; never promote manually. Your local tooling talks to Relay's staging endpoint for all contract work. Requests must be authenticated, and contractors use a scoped staging key rather than personal credentials. That key is provided below.

app token of tagef-tafog = qvz3-7n0